[docs]class VideoCompressor(object): """Class for performing video compression task: based on ffmpeg library for doing video compression""" def __init__(self): # Find out location of ffmpeg binary on system helper._set_ffmpeg_binary_path()
[docs] @FileDecorators.validate_file_path def compress_video( self, file_path, force_overwrite, crf_parameter, output_video_codec, out_dir_path, out_file_name, ): """Function to compress given input file :param file_path: Input file path :type file_path: str :param force_overwrite: optional parameter if True then if there is \ already a file in output file location function will overwrite it, defaults to False :type force_overwrite: bool, optional :param crf_parameter: Constant Rate Factor Parameter for controlling \ amount of video compression to be applied, The range of the quantizer scale is 0-51:\ where 0 is lossless, 23 is default, and 51 is worst possible.\ It is recommend to keep this value between 20 to 30 \ A lower value is a higher quality, you can change default value by changing \ config.Video.video_compression_crf_parameter :type crf_parameter: int, optional :param output_video_codec: Type of video codec to choose, \ Currently supported options are libx264 and libx265, libx264 is default option.\ libx264 is more widely supported on different operating systems and platforms, \ libx265 uses more advanced x265 codec and results in better compression and even less \ output video sizes with same or better quality. Right now libx265 is not as widely compatible \ on older versions of MacOS and Widows by default. If wider video compatibility is your goal \ you should use libx264., you can change default value by changing \ Katna.config.Video.video_compression_codec :type output_video_codec: str, optional :param out_dir_path: output folder path where you want output video to be saved, defaults to "" :type out_dir_path: str, optional :param out_file_name: output filename, if not mentioned it will be same as input filename, defaults to "" :type out_file_name: str, optional :raises Exception: raises FileNotFoundError Exception if input video file not found, also exception is raised in case output video file path already exist and force_overwrite is not set to True. :return: Status code Returns True if video compression was successfull else False :rtype: bool """ if not helper._check_if_valid_video(file_path): raise Exception("Invalid or corrupted video: " + file_path) output_full_file_name = self._generate_target_full_file_name( file_path, out_dir_path, out_file_name ) if os.path.exists(output_full_file_name) is True and force_overwrite is False: exceptionMsg = ( "Target video name already exist: " + output_full_file_name + "\nPass on parameter force_overwrite=True in video.compress_video() function to force overwrite" ) raise Exception(exceptionMsg) status = self._compress_video_using_ffmpeg( file_path, crf_parameter, output_video_codec, output_full_file_name ) return status
def _generate_target_full_file_name(self, file_path, out_dir_path, out_file_name): """Internal function to generate output video file name given input video file_path, out_dir_path and out_file_name :param file_path: Input Video file path :type file_path: str :param out_dir_path: output folder path where you want output video to be saved, defaults to "" :type out_dir_path: str :param out_file_name: output filename, if not mentioned it will be same as input filename, defaults to "" :type out_file_name: str :return: Generated output video file path :rtype: str """ # If output directory is not mentioned save compressed video in input dir if out_dir_path == "": out_dir_path = ntpath.dirname(file_path) if out_file_name != "": targetname = os.path.join(out_dir_path, out_file_name) else: # if output filename not mentioned make filename same as input file name, _ = os.path.splitext(ntpath.basename(file_path)) targetname = os.path.join(out_dir_path, name) # Use mp4 extension for target regardless of input extension ext = config.Video.compression_output_file_extension target_full_file_name = "{0}.{1}".format(targetname, ext) # if target_file_name is same as input file name, # save it with extension "_compressed" if target_full_file_name == file_path: target_full_file_name = "{0}_compressed.{1}".format(targetname, ext) return target_full_file_name def _compress_video_using_ffmpeg( self, filename, crf_parameter, output_video_codec, targetname ): """Internal function to compress a input file with ffmpeg using given codec :param file_path: Input file path :type file_path: str :param crf_parameter: Constant Rate Factor Parameter for controlling amount of video compression to be applied, The range of the quantizer scale is 0-51: where 0 is lossless, 23 is default, and 51 is worst possible. A lower value is a higher quality, defaults to config.Video.video_compression_crf_parameter :type crf_parameter: int :param output_video_codec: Type of video codec to choose, Current Options: libx264 and libx265,libx264 is default and is more compatible to wide range of Operating system, libx265 gives better compression at expense of compatibility, defaults to config.Video.video_compression_codec :type output_video_codec: str :param targetname: path where output compressed video file to be stored :type targetname: str :return: Status code Returns True if video compression was successfull else False :rtype: bool """ ffmpeg_output_parameters = ( "-vcodec " + output_video_codec + " -crf " + str(crf_parameter) ) # Uses ffmpeg binary for video clipping using ffmpy wrapper FFMPEG_BINARY = os.getenv("FFMPEG_BINARY") ff = ffmpy.FFmpeg( executable=FFMPEG_BINARY, inputs={filename: "-y -hide_banner -nostats -loglevel panic"}, outputs={targetname: ffmpeg_output_parameters}, ) try: ff.run() except ffmpy.FFRuntimeError: return False return True
